The Growing Popularity of Wireless Headphones
The shift from wired to wireless headphones has been propelled by several aspects:
Convenience: Wireless headphones get rid of the trouble of tangled cords. This ease of use has made them a preferred for those on the relocation.
Improved Technology: Advancements in Bluetooth technology have significantly enhanced sound quality and connection. Modern wireless headphones typically include noise-cancellation, touch controls, and long battery life.
Diverse Options: The market is flooded with choices, from over-the-ear designs to compact in-ear models, accommodating the preferences of various customers.

The UK provides a host of sales occasions throughout the year that can be advantageous for customers looking to purchase wireless headphones. These include:
Black Friday: Typically falling in late November, this event sees considerable discounts throughout many sellers.
Cyber Monday: Following Black Friday, Cyber Monday concentrates on online sales, supplying customers with ample opportunities to protect deals on tech products, consisting of wireless headphones.
January Sales: The post-holiday sales often feature excellent rates on remaining stock, making it a perfect time for deal hunters.
April Sales: As the tax year finishes up, numerous merchants will often clear old stock with reduced offerings.

When buying wireless headphones during a sale, a couple of strategies can help make sure a satisfactory purchase:
Determine Your Needs: Consider how you plan to use the headphones. For example, are they for commuting, sports, or home listening?
Set a Budget: Knowing just how much you're willing to spend can help limit options throughout sales.
Check out Reviews: Customers often leave evaluations that can inform you about sound quality, convenience, and toughness.
Inspect Return Policies: Retailers typically have various return policies, so comprehending them will help in case the headphones do not satisfy expectations.
Stay Updated on Deals: Subscribing to newsletters or following retailers on social networks can keep you notified about flash sales and unique deals.
